varying revs at idle Sun, 15 June 2003 09:42 Go to next message
hey guys
recently over the last few months i have noticed that my car varies revs at idle.

when slowing down to a stop the car will drop revs to about 600rpm and start to idle rough then jump back up to idle at around 800rpm. it idles jsut a tad rougher now.

it never used to do this. i dont have the AC on or anything else when it happens

could it be a dirty fuel filter?

car in question is a 96 camry V6

sounds like it could be a vacume leak pour some water around the inlet mainifold around gaskets and injectors see if it stops or runs really bad if so u found the leak
